| Software | Similar to ProShow? | Key feature | |----------|---------------------|--------------| | DaVinci Resolve (free) | Yes (but steeper learning curve) | Fusion page for keyframe animation; style packs via "effects templates" | | MAGIX Photostory (paid) | Moderate | More automated, less timeline control | | CyberLink PowerDirector (paid) | Moderate | Has "slideshow styles" but fewer layers | | Adobe Premiere Pro (subscription) | Advanced | Custom Motion Graphics templates (.mogrt) act like style packs |

Photodex ProShow Producer is a professional slideshow-creation application (Windows) used to combine photos, video clips, and music into polished, animated presentations.
